Advanced Equipment for Wire Processing: Coiling and Twisting Overview

A contemporary wire fabrication process relies heavily on specialized equipment for coiling , twisting , and manipulating the cable. Winders precisely shape the wire into coils , ensuring even diameter and stress. Spiralers then merge multiple wires to create the completed component. Robotic transfer systems further minimize workforce charges and enhance productivity . Proper equipment selection is vital for attaining desired strand properties and ensuring high grade.
